KMB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2015 in Review

1,205 of the 3,753 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Kimberly-Clark (KMB) for Q1 2015, worth a combined $26.6B — down 10% from $29.6B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 76 funds opened new KMB positions and 56 closed out — a net gain of 20 holders — while 482 added to existing stakes and 442 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Adage Capital Partners, opening a new position worth an estimated $90.2M. The largest seller was Americafirst Capital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$553M sold.
